## Hot-reload checklist (read before approving)

Quick reminder for reviewers: the Pinwheel config watcher reloads anything under `conf.d/` within about two seconds, so any change merged here goes live without a restart. Check that new keys have sane defaults, because a missing key during reload crashes the watcher thread (yes, still). The reload endpoint itself is gated by a signing credential the watcher reads from `.env` at boot. That file needs the following line added.

env line for fafof-fahag: LEDGER_TOKEN5=f8790

## 2.9.0 — Changed defaults

The Quillbase JavaScript and Kotlin SDKs now share identical defaults to close the parity gap tracked since 2.7. Retry backoff, pagination size, and offline cache TTL were aligned to the Kotlin values, as those matched server expectations. If you pinned overrides, re-check them. The new shared defaults are listed below.

deployment values, yahog-bawip:
OLIION_PIN=2765
OLIION_TENANT=wenael
OLIION_METRICS_HOST=metrics.oliion.qorveltech.test
OLIION_SEAL=seal_27b6b67a
OLIION_STANDBY_TEAM=drudor

## Ferngate wiki: environment overview

Ferngate's role-based access rules are evaluated per environment, so a page visible to editors in staging may be admin-only in production. Always verify role mappings after promoting content, since mismatches silently hide pages rather than erroring. The access-control service in each environment reads the following configuration.

settings of kafog-yajeg:
[casok]
team = noviel
access_code = ac_87fc10
host = casok.brasklabs.internal
port = 9300
owner = rusix.fraax
peer = aldax.merlaqcorp.corp